6 gamblers held by Udhampur police

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, Aug 1: Police arrested six gamblers along with Rs 16,500 stake money and playing cards from MH Road here today. As per police sources, on specific inputs, police party from Udhampur police station conducted a raid near MH Road and arrested six gamblers along with Rs 16,500 stake money and playing cards. The accused have been identified as Mohammad Riaz, son of Mohammad Alam of Chekherh, Inderjeet Sharma, son of Hem Raj of Billian Bowli, Anil Kumar, son of Bhywan Singh of Jakhani, Mubarkh Mohammad, son of Sharief Mohammad of Pancheri, Sanjeev, son of Prem Nath of Ramnagar and Vishal Singh, son of Jodh Singh of Jakhani. A case under Gambling Act has been registered at Udhampur police station and investigation started. Police team headed by SHO Udhampur Police Station Mahesh Sharma made the arrest under the supervision of DySP Headquarters Gourav Mahajan and SSP Udhampur Mohammad Suleman Choudhary.
